A Word from the Pastor
Invitation Church was started after a long process of seeking God on how to answer the call that He had placed on my life. I had served as a youth pastor and an associate pastor of other churches, but it was on a mission trip to Seattle where God specifically called me to plant a church in Monroe, NC.
As I reflect upon God’s call to being this work, it’s interesting that I was in Seattle to help a new church plant when He called me to this work. Before the trip, I had no idea what church planting was all about.
On a separate trip to Honduras, it became clear that it was time to begin this work in September of 2014. Our first service was then held on September 7, 2014, where 7 people attended. It has been a wonderful adventure since that day, and we continue to seek where God is working so that we can join Him in the work that He is doing in our community.
